Locking the Door
Volvo's remote keyfobs allow you to unlock your vehicle's tailgate, doors and fuel filler flap with the push of a button. Remote key fobs can also switch on the ignition and set off the alarm. volvo key fob shell can also operate the sunroof when it's equipped. You'll never have to look for your keys, or have to worry about locking out of your vehicle.

You might not be aware of some key fob features that are not visible. One of these features is an unlocked/lock button that can be pressed in the event the battery on your key fob goes out.
To press the manual lock/unlock switch, hold your key fob with the Volvo logo side up. Find the black button on the edge of your key fob, and gently press it. This will open a protective cover that hides the key blade that is manual. The cover can be flipped counterclockwise by using a flathead or coin.

Closing the Windows
One of the lesser-known features that is not visible on Volvo key fobs is that you can lower all windows at once by using them. This is a great feature when trying to squeeze into a cramped parking spot, or even just to get fresh air in the cabin while driving.
To unlock your Volvo do this, press and hold down the unlock button on your Volvo remote for four seconds. This will lower all the windows, and the sunroof, if your car has one. After that, once you're done with the car you can shut the doors by pressing the lock button a second time for four seconds.
